Before you dig in Apache Junction

Arizona requires a Arizona 811 locate before excavation, and Apache Junction is no exception, so request marks at 811 ahead of time. Arizona requires 2 working days notice before excavation. Is a hydro excavator the same as a hydrovac truck?

They are closely related. "Hydro excavator" emphasizes the digging role of a vacuum excavation rig, while "hydrovac truck" names the vehicle. Both use pressurized water and a vacuum to dig safely around buried utilities.

When is a hydro excavator the right choice?

When you need controlled, precise excavation in congested or critical areas, such as exposing transmission lines, trenching among dense utilities, or deep potholing where a mechanical excavator would be too risky.
